About Amerisource Bergen

AmerisourceBergen Corporation is a pharmaceutical distribution company headquartered in Chesterbrook, Pennsylvania. It was founded in 2001 through the merger of AmeriSource Health Corporation and Bergen Brunswig Corporation. The company distributes a wide range of pharmaceutical products, including brand-name and generic drugs, specialty drugs, and over-the-counter medications. AmerisourceBergen serves healthcare providers, including hospitals, pharmacies, and physician practices, as well as pharmaceutical manufacturers. The company is committed to sustainability and has implemented several initiatives to reduce its environmental impact.
